Number of deaths in South Sudan
South Sudan: Number of deaths was 99,239 deaths in 2021. ▲ Rising
Number of deaths in South Sudan, 2000–2021
Source: World Health Organization (2024) – with major processing by Our World in Data. Measured in deaths.
Analysis
In 2021, number of deaths in South Sudan stood at 99,239 deaths.
That represents a change of up 3.0% on the previous year and up 2.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, number of deaths in South Sudan peaked at 105,307 deaths in 2014 and was at its lowest, 89,321 deaths, in 2005.
That places South Sudan 84th out of 194 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 22 years of available data.
Number of deaths in South Sudan, year by year
| Year | deaths |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 92,566 deaths | — |
| 2001 | 91,517 deaths | -1.1% |
| 2002 | 91,207 deaths | -0.3% |
| 2003 | 90,932 deaths | -0.3% |
| 2004 | 89,787 deaths | -1.3% |
| 2005 | 89,321 deaths | -0.5% |
| 2006 | 89,630 deaths | +0.3% |
| 2007 | 89,543 deaths | -0.1% |
| 2008 | 90,196 deaths | +0.7% |
| 2009 | 93,079 deaths | +3.2% |
| 2010 | 93,157 deaths | +0.1% |
| 2011 | 96,908 deaths | +4.0% |
| 2012 | 99,404 deaths | +2.6% |
| 2013 | 104,393 deaths | +5.0% |
| 2014 | 105,307 deaths | +0.9% |
| 2015 | 103,837 deaths | -1.4% |
| 2016 | 102,560 deaths | -1.2% |
| 2017 | 99,850 deaths | -2.6% |
| 2018 | 96,140 deaths | -3.7% |
| 2019 | 94,674 deaths | -1.5% |
| 2020 | 96,370 deaths | +1.8% |
| 2021 | 99,239 deaths | +3.0% |
